Output e1db33f929e004a423f528609cb116bc3ebc9a9896d6d4fbb4c1cc6a6eaf6eff:0

value
478378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ebfd780842dae770005c26b21ec50330b195af3 OP_EQUAL
address
3DFCt7ihdehZE2VbkwMR86csFoqrJ4Leus
transaction
e1db33f929e004a423f528609cb116bc3ebc9a9896d6d4fbb4c1cc6a6eaf6eff
spent
true